Test-plan note: Bramleaf consent banner rollout

Scope: verify the banner renders before any non-essential scripts load, consent state persists across sessions, and withdrawal purges stored preferences within one request cycle. Negative cases cover blocked storage, expired consent records, and region-override headers. All consent writes are logged to the Bramleaf audit sink for reviewer inspection; no test should bypass the consent gate. Automated runs call the consent API in staging and authenticate using the bearer token below.

login token, bagug-kafop: eyJhbGciOiJIUzI1NiIsInR5cCI6IkpXVCJ9.eyJzdWIiOiIcMLov2In0.Z5RLDIfp

# Break-Glass: Catalog Cache Invalidation

Scope: the Pinrow product catalog at Veldstone Retail. If stale prices persist after a purge and the Hollowmere invalidation queue is wedged, use break-glass to flush the edge tier directly. Contractors: get verbal sign-off from the catalog lead first. Steps: open the Hollowmere admin shell, select emergency-flush, confirm the tenant, and run it once — repeated flushes thrash the origin. Access is logged and expires after 20 minutes. Unseal the admin shell with the passphrase below.

recovery phrase for kahop-tajog: istix-casvan

Ticket DRIFT-214: nightly cron drift job failing signature verification since the 3.1 deploy. The verifier rejects the drift-report artifact because it was signed with the rotated key while the agent still pins the old fingerprint. Fix: update the pinned fingerprint on all Harwell-cluster agents, then re-sign last night's report. For future maintainers, the current signing key is recorded below.

release key, kawif-hawep: bky13_X7TGuRG4Zu4ZJ

Minutes — Management Meeting, Tolvane Systems

Attendees reviewed the proposed expansion into the Ardessa region. Marta Quillen presented cost projections; warehouse leasing in Port Velmor was approved in principle. Finance to model currency exposure by next session. Timing depends on the confidential arrangement summarised below.

confidential, haduf-bajog: Oliokox Group plans to lower the Wenwyn list price by 32 percent in July.